The Three-Tier Restriction System: No Parking, Standing, and Stopping

Brookhaven drivers must distinguish between three critical restriction types. No parking means you cannot leave your vehicle unattended, though brief stops for passenger drop-off are permitted. No standing prohibits stopping entirely unless you're actively loading or unloading people or cargo. No stopping is the most restrictive—you cannot stop even momentarily, regardless of occupancy. These distinctions are legally binding and violations result in fines ranging from $30 to $100 CAD depending on the offense. Near the GO Transit - Weston Subdivision station, these rules are enforced rigorously during commute periods.

The hierarchy matters because confusion costs money and time. Signs displaying these restrictions appear near transit hubs, school zones, and fire hydrants throughout Brookhaven. Many drivers assume a brief stop won't matter, but enforcement officers patrol these areas consistently. To avoid penalties, read every sign carefully before stopping your vehicle. Multi-Panel Signs: Reading the Rules Top to Bottom

Multi-panel parking signs dominate Brookhaven's streetscape and confuse many drivers because they layer multiple restrictions into one unit. The golden rule is simple: read from top to bottom. The top panel states the primary restriction, middle panels indicate exceptions or time-based rules, and bottom panels show directional arrows that clarify which spots are affected. A black arrow pointing away from your vehicle signals where restrictions apply. This systematic approach eliminates guesswork and ensures compliance.

Specifics matter enormously when decoding these signs. You might see notation like "Mon-Fri 8am-6pm" or "Except Sun & Holidays," which dramatically changes what's permitted. Near MacTier Subdivision station, signs frequently specify parking is allowed only on weekends or after business hours. Many violations occur because drivers misread these temporal conditions or fail to notice directional arrows entirely. Clearway Zones and Tow-Away Enforcement in Brookhaven

Clearway activation periods demand your strictest attention because violations trigger immediate consequences. A clearway prohibits all stopping during specified hours—typically during morning and evening rush periods—to maintain traffic flow. In Brookhaven, clearways near major transit corridors are enforced aggressively. Violation fines start at $100 CAD, and your vehicle can be towed within minutes of the restriction period beginning. Signage clearly displays these time windows, but drivers who ignore them pay dearly.

Tow-away zones are marked with bold red circles or explicit "No Stopping Any Time" text, meaning parking is prohibited around the clock. These appear near fire hydrants, bus stops, and emergency access routes. Even if your vehicle is occupied, you cannot legally stop in a tow-away zone. Brookhaven enforcement teams monitor these areas continuously, and recovery costs exceed $300 plus daily storage fees.
